WebFarms 30 miles away from a town with a population of 30,000 or more may have difficulty attracting customers, as will a farm 50 miles away from a city of 100,000. Most PYO operations should start small. Studies of Illinois strawberry farms show that about 400 customers are needed to clear an acre of strawberries with a 10,000 pound yield, and ... Dig large holes where you plan to plant the pumpkins and fill them with a … WebVining pumpkins require a minimum of 50 to 100 square feet per hill. Plant seeds one inch deep (four or five seeds per hill). Allow 5 to 6 feet between hills, spaced in rows 10 to 15 feet apart. WebApr 11, 2024 · Alternatively, place 2 to 3 pumpkin seeds in each hill and space hills 4 to 8 to four apart. It’s important to locate your pumpkins in full sun and add plenty of compost to your soil prior to planting. Keeping your pumpkin patch well-weeded and checking for pests will also help support healthy vines and encourage pumpkins to grow larger.
